In all honesty I can't judge the durability of the sliding steering rack on the 22. I haven't had my 22 for that long, but I did buy it second hand and the previous owner gave me a very worn out one in the spares bag. Was this due to a design fault or lack of maintenance and cleaning? I don't know.

I do like the 22's steering for its compactness, I do worry a little about durability but then again with regular cleaning there's a chance it could be OK.

There's nothing wrong with old fashioned "80s" bellcrank designs, I've had those last an eternity! Over 15 years and only changed it as the plastic got ugly and yellow.
